How do the HOX genes in the paddlefish match the HOX genes in human

    Hox are transcription factors that are evolutionarily conserved across bilaterians and, therefore, they share sequence homology between paddlefish and humans.

    Explanation:

    The Hox genes represent a family of homeodomain transcription factors that play roles in the development of the axial and appendicular skeleton, being therefore critical during embryonic development. In this case, the human Hox genes are homologous to homeobox genes found in the paddlefish. These genes have a DNA-binding domain of 60 amino acids which is evolutionarily conserved in bilaterian species including paddlefish and human species.
